What they do
A Building and General Maintenance Technician performs building maintenance and appliance repairs for an apartment complex, housing division, residential center or business, as directed by a property manager.
$49,727 / year median in Washington
+13% projected growth

Legend Brands, an industry leader and long-standing, stable company, combines over 185 years of experience in providing equipment, accessories and chemicals for professional cleaning, facility maintenance, portable environmental control, fire remediation and water damage restoration. Job Summary Under general supervision, the Production Maintenance Technician is responsible for performing repairs, maintenance, and operational activities in support of manufacturing. This role supports the maintenance of manufacturing equipment, hand tools, molds, fixtures, and gauges, including spare parts inventory. The PMT II helps establish and maintain preventive maintenance programs, participates in new equipment installations, and assists manufacturing by evaluating needs, researching tools and equipment, and developing fixtures and shop aids. None Essential Duties Provide maintenance support for all process equipment, including repair of down equipment and coordination of maintenance projects Analyze, troubleshoot, and diagnose equipment, machine, and process-related issues Perform maintenance, fabrication, adjustments, and repairs on machinery and equipment Maintain spare parts inventory, order tools and parts, and ensure accurate maintenance records Improve and execute preventive maintenance plans, including operator-level procedures Perform scheduled preventive maintenance activities Install, set up, evaluate, and recommend improvements for new and existing equipment Modify equipment to optimize performance Coordinate fabrication of fixtures and shop aids Ensure compliance with health, safety, and environmental requirements Strong understanding of pneumatic /electrical drills, grinders, routers, and motors. Strong understanding of electrical, hydraulic and other systems, general maintenance processes and methods, power tools, welders and machine shop equipment. Strong problem-solving skills including equipment breakdown, performing repairs and installation. Previous welding experience required, certification preferred Perform other related duties as assigned Minimum Qualifications High School Diploma or GED required. Relevant maintenance experience preferred Employment Standards Knowledge of Lockout/Tagout (LOTO) and PPE requirements Knowledge of maintenance methods, tools, and equipment Strong verbal and written communication skills Strong problem-solving skills Basic shop math skills Ability to work independently and follow direction Ability to work overtime as needed Ability to pass a pre-employment background check Ability to work in confined spaces and utilize fall protection Ability to pass a pre-employment background check. Hiring Range Between $28.00 - $34.75 per hour.
